5 favourites – March

This has been a very strange, very different month. For the whole world sadly. I’ve been working from home for the past 2,5 weeks, and let me tell you, I really miss going to work. I’m a teacher and I love teaching, but virtual teaching is not to be preferred in my opinion. But it’s better than no teaching at all. I haven’t written much about the current situation at all, and I’m not going to, but I have mentioned that I still get properly dressed and do my make-up every day to stay sane. In fact, I’ve actually been very inspired when it comes to outfits and make-up looks, and I have discovered some new favourites in those departments. So here goes; March favourites.

Topshop hoops

Flat hoop earrings: These flat hoops (I guess you can call them that) from Topshop has without a doubt been my most worn earrings this past month. I always love a good hoop, but there’s something I really like about these ones that makes me wear them all the time.

Maybelline Dream Urban Cover foundation (shade: 100 Warm Ivory): I very rarely find new foundations that I like as much as my favourite Maybelline Fit Me Matte + Poreless foundation, but I think I like this one (also by Maybelline) almost as much as the Fit Me one. It’s the only foundation I’ve been wearing since I did my first impressions one it, and that says a lot.

Jeffree Star Cosmetics Blood Lust palette: Another Jeffree Star palette, another winner. It’s really hard to beat the JS eyeshadow formula in my opinion, and purple is my favourite colour (and I’m loving purple eyeshadows at the moment), so this is just what I needed in my eyeshadow palette collection.

MAC Glow Play blush (shade: Grand): This new blush formula from MAC feels like a mix between a powder blush and a cream blush. I’m usually not into cream blushes, but I love this one. The texture, colour, and finish are all stunning.
